Поделиться через


sp_cursorclose (Transact-SQL)

Область применения:SQL Server

Закрывает и освобождает курсор и освобождает все связанные ресурсы; То есть она удаляет временную таблицу, используемую в поддержке KEYSET или STATIC курсора. sp_cursorclose вызывается путем ID = 9 указания в пакете табличного потока данных (TDS).

Соглашения о синтаксисе Transact-SQL

Синтаксис

sp_cursorclose cursor
[ ; ]

Аргументы

Важный

Аргументы для расширенных хранимых процедур необходимо ввести в определенном порядке, как описано в разделе Синтаксис. Если параметры введены вне порядка, возникает сообщение об ошибке.

курсор

Значение дескриптора курсораsp_cursoropen Параметр курсора является intи не может бытьNULL.

Входное -1 значение применяется ко всем курсорам текущего соединения.

Замечания

курсор вернет сообщения об ошибках, если процедура была запущена после закрытия курсора или если указан недопустимый дескриптор.

Состояние RPC обозначает общий успех или общий неуспех.

DONE строка всегда 0.